"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"queue.h" between
memcached-1.6.12.tar.gz and memcached-1.6.13.tar.gz

About: memcached is a high-performance, distributed memory object caching system, generic in nature, but originally intended for use in speeding up dynamic web applications by alleviating database load.

queue.h  (memcached-1.6.12):queue.h  (memcached-1.6.13)
skipping to change at line 40 skipping to change at line 40
* O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F * O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F
* SUCH DAMAGE. * SUCH DAMAGE.
* *
* @(#)queue.h 8.5 (Berkeley) 8/20/94 * @(#)queue.h 8.5 (Berkeley) 8/20/94
* $FreeBSD$ * $FreeBSD$
*/ */
#ifndef _SYS_QUEUE_H_ #ifndef _SYS_QUEUE_H_
#define _SYS_QUEUE_H_ #define _SYS_QUEUE_H_
#include <sys/cdefs.h>
/* /*
* This file defines four types of data structures: singly-linked lists, * This file defines four types of data structures: singly-linked lists,
* singly-linked tail queues, lists and tail queues. * singly-linked tail queues, lists and tail queues.
* *
* A singly-linked list is headed by a single forward pointer. The elements * A singly-linked list is headed by a single forward pointer. The elements
* are singly linked for minimum space and pointer manipulation overhead at * are singly linked for minimum space and pointer manipulation overhead at
* the expense of O(n) removal for arbitrary elements. New elements can be * the expense of O(n) removal for arbitrary elements. New elements can be
* added to the list after an existing element or at the head of the list. * added to the list after an existing element or at the head of the list.
* Elements being removed from the head of the list should use the explicit * Elements being removed from the head of the list should use the explicit
* macro for this purpose for optimum efficiency. A singly-linked list may * macro for this purpose for optimum efficiency. A singly-linked list may
 End of changes. 1 change blocks. 
2 lines changed or deleted 0 lines changed or added

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)